UL

U. L. Consultants Ltd

Unknown
View U. L. Consultants Ltd's full profile

Employees

UL
Upul Liyanage
Immigration Consultant At U. L. Consultants Ltd at U. L. Consultants Ltd
+* *** *** ** **
********@*****.***
Show all employees

U. L. Consultants Ltd Details

Website
City
Edgware, United Kingdom